Miniature Book. Gift-type hardcover issued in dust jacket. Selections of wit and wisdom taken from Benjamin Franklin's famous Poor Richard's Almanack. Illustrated with vintage woodcuts. From the dust jacket flap: "Looking for advice that has stood the test of time? Ready for pithy pointers from the origianl instruction book for life?" Some of the famous quotes include: "A true friend is the best possession."; "Eary to bed and early to rise, makes a man healthy, wealthy, and wise."; "No gains without Pains".
